Hyderabad, Jan. 3 -- The Telangana Assembly on Saturday evening passed the Panchayat Raj (Amendment) Bill, 2026, abolishing the two-child norm that disqualified individuals with more than two children from contesting local body elections.
Introducing the Bill, Panchayat Raj Minister Danasari Anasuya Seethakka said the policy, first enacted in 1994, was aimed at controlling population growth during the 1980s and 1990s, a period marked by food insecurity, unemployment, and widespread poverty.
